Proof of Work: Jak działa i dlaczego jest ważny?

Czym jest proof of work w kontekście kryptowalut?

Proof of work, często skracane jako PoW, to fundamentalny mechanizm konsensusu wykorzystywany przez wiele kryptowalut, w tym historycznie przez Bitcoin. Jego głównym celem jest zapewnienie bezpieczeństwa sieci blockchain poprzez wymaganie od uczestników (tzw. górników) wykonania znaczącej pracy obliczeniowej. Ta praca polega na rozwiązywaniu skomplikowanych problemów matematycznych. Sukces w rozwiązaniu problemu pozwala górnikowi na dodanie nowego bloku transakcji do łańcucha i otrzymanie w nagrodę nowo wyemitowanych kryptowalut oraz opłat transakcyjnych. PoW jest kluczowy dla utrzymania integralności i decentralizacji sieci, uniemożliwiając fałszowanie transakcji czy podwójne wydawanie środków.

Jak wygląda proces wydobycia w proof of work?

Proces wydobycia w systemie proof of work jest energochłonny i wymaga dużej mocy obliczeniowej. Górnicy używają specjalistycznego sprzętu, takiego jak układy ASIC lub karty graficzne (GPU), aby wielokrotnie próbować rozwiązać zagadkę kryptograficzną. Zagadka ta polega na znalezieniu liczby (zwanej nonce), która po połączeniu z danymi transakcji i nagłówkiem bloku, przy zastosowaniu funkcji skrótu (np. SHA-256), daje wynik (hash) spełniający określone kryterium trudności. Kryterium to zazwyczaj oznacza, że hash musi zaczynać się od określonej liczby zer. Im więcej zer jest wymaganych, tym trudniejsze jest znalezienie rozwiązania, co zwiększa czas potrzebny na wydobycie bloku i zużycie energii.

Bezpieczeństwo sieci dzięki proof of work

Główną zaletą proof of work jest jego wysoki poziom bezpieczeństwa, który wynika z samej natury mechanizmu. Aby zaatakować sieć opartą na PoW, atakujący musiałby dysponować znaczną większością całkowitej mocy obliczeniowej sieci (tzw. atak 51%). Posiadanie tak ogromnej mocy obliczeniowej wiązałoby się z gigantycznymi kosztami sprzętu i energii elektrycznej, co czyni atak nieopłacalnym i niezwykle trudnym do przeprowadzenia, zwłaszcza w przypadku dużych i dobrze ugruntowanych kryptowalut jak Bitcoin. Każdy nowy blok dodany do łańcucha jest powiązany z poprzednim, tworząc niezmienny zapis historii transakcji, który jest trudny do manipulacji.

Wyzwania i wady proof of work

Pomimo swoich zalet, proof of work boryka się z istotnymi wyzwaniami, z których największym jest wysokie zużycie energii elektrycznej. Proces wydobycia wymaga nieustannego działania potężnych maszyn obliczeniowych, co przekłada się na znaczący ślad węglowy i budzi obawy dotyczące wpływu na środowisko. Ponadto, konkurencja w wydobyciu prowadzi do centralizacji mocy obliczeniowej w rękach dużych kopalni, które mogą sobie pozwolić na zakup najnowszego i najbardziej wydajnego sprzętu. Skutkuje to nierównym podziałem nagród i potencjalnie mniejszą decentralizacją sieci.

Proof of work a zużycie energii

Kwestia zużycia energii jest prawdopodobnie najbardziej kontrowersyjnym aspektem proof of work. Roczne zużycie energii przez sieć Bitcoin porównywane jest do zużycia energii przez niektóre kraje. Choć zwolennicy argumentują, że energia ta jest wykorzystywana do zabezpieczania globalnego systemu finansowego, krytycy wskazują na potrzebę poszukiwania bardziej ekologicznych alternatyw. Rozwój technologii i poszukiwanie rozwiązań zrównoważonych energetycznie są kluczowe dla przyszłości branży kryptowalut. Wiele nowych projektów blockchain rezygnuje z PoW na rzecz bardziej energooszczędnych mechanizmów konsensusu.

Alternatywy dla proof of work

W odpowiedzi na problemy związane z PoW, społeczność kryptowalut opracowała szereg alternatywnych mechanizmów konsensusu. Najpopularniejszą alternatywą jest Proof of Stake (PoS), gdzie bezpieczeństwo sieci jest zapewniane przez walidatorów, którzy „zastawiają” swoje kryptowaluty, aby móc tworzyć nowe bloki. Inne mechanizmy to Proof of Authority (PoA), Proof of Elapsed Time (PoET) czy Directed Acyclic Graphs (DAG). Każdy z nich ma swoje wady i zalety, ale wspólnym celem jest osiągnięcie podobnego poziomu bezpieczeństwa przy znacznie niższym zużyciu energii.

Jak proof of work wpływa na inflację kryptowalut?

Proof of work odgrywa kluczową rolę w kontrolowaniu inflacji kryptowalut poprzez mechanizm nagród za wydobycie. Nowe jednostki kryptowaluty są emitowane jako nagroda dla górników, którzy pomyślnie dodadzą nowy blok. Zazwyczaj, aby zapobiec nadmiernej inflacji, protokół kryptowaluty określa stałą lub malejącą szybkość emisji nowych monet. W przypadku Bitcoina, nagroda za wydobycie jest zmniejszana o połowę co około cztery lata (tzw. halving), co stopniowo ogranicza tempo wprowadzania nowych monet do obiegu i sprawia, że kryptowaluta staje się bardziej deflacyjna w dłuższej perspektywie.

Przyszłość proof of work w świecie kryptowalut

Przyszłość proof of work jest tematem gorących dyskusji. Choć PoW udowodnił swoją skuteczność w zabezpieczaniu sieci przez lata, jego wady związane z energetyką i potencjalną centralizacją sprawiają, że wiele nowych projektów wybiera inne rozwiązania. Jednakże, dla kryptowalut, które już z sukcesem wykorzystują PoW, takich jak Bitcoin, przejście na inny mechanizm jest ogromnym wyzwaniem technicznym i logistycznym. Możliwe jest, że PoW będzie nadal odgrywał rolę w niektórych niszach lub w połączeniu z innymi technologiami, ale ogólny trend wskazuje na coraz większe zainteresowanie bardziej zrównoważonymi alternatywami.

Porównanie proof of work z innymi mechanizmami konsensusu

Aby lepiej zrozumieć miejsce proof of work, warto porównać go z innymi popularnymi mechanizmami. Proof of Stake (PoS) jest często postrzegany jako główny konkurent, oferując znacznie niższe zużycie energii. W PoS, zamiast mocy obliczeniowej, liczy się ilość posiadanej kryptowaluty i jej „zastawienie”. W zamian za bezpieczeństwo sieci, walidatorzy otrzymują nagrody, podobnie jak górnicy w PoW. Inne mechanizmy, jak Proof of History (PoH) używany przez Solana, starają się zoptymalizować czas potrzebny na weryfikację transakcji i konsensus. Każdy mechanizm ma swoje unikalne podejście do rozwiązywania problemu dystrybucji i zabezpieczania zdecentralizowanej sieci.

Jak zacząć przygodę z wydobyciem proof of work?

Rozpoczęcie przygody z wydobyciem kryptowalut opartych na proof of work wymaga pewnych inwestycji i wiedzy. Po pierwsze, należy wybrać kryptowalutę, którą chcemy wydobywać, biorąc pod uwagę jej rentowność i trudność wydobycia. Następnie potrzebny jest odpowiedni sprzęt – zazwyczaj wyspecjalizowane koparki ASIC lub wydajne karty graficzne. Niezbędne jest również posiadanie portfela kryptowalutowego do przechowywania zarobionych środków oraz dołączenie do puli wydobywczej. Pule te agregują moc obliczeniową wielu górników, co zwiększa szanse na regularne otrzymywanie nagród, zamiast polegania na pojedynczych próbach. Pamiętaj o analizie kosztów energii elektrycznej, ponieważ jest to kluczowy czynnik wpływający na opłacalność.

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*